Decorating Costs

The cost of the paint, and or any testers to keep, is not included. Tester paint pots range from £2-£6 and I suggest purchasing a tester pot of all or any colours suggested.

The premium paint brands that I work with offer superb finishes with lower VOC’s. Costs range from around £60 for a 2.5 litre pot (enough for a compact room) and a £100-£130 for a 5 litre pot (enough for an average master bedroom). A kitchen/diner or hallway may require 2 or more 5 litre pots.

Whilst annoying for a budget and to store, I advise having some spare paint left enabling you to touch up any big marks made in the future.

If you are looking to use a painter / decorator, costs differ depending on the work you are looking to do. For a large and more complex space, they may need 2-5 days to prep and fulfil all coats, on all surfaces, and can typically charge £150 - £250 a day.
